Myrtle Beach International Airport Independent Fee Analysis

Dennis Corporation provided an independent fee analysis for the Myrtle Beach International Airport, which involved an analysis of the milling and pavement overlay design project for Runway 18-36. The project had to be designed to be constructed in phases involving 100% night-work with runway closures allowed between 12:00 am and 5:00 am. Dennis Corporation created a detailed cost analysis/estimate for the project. As stated in the FAA’s Advisory Circular 150/5100-14D, section 2-12, a fee analysis must be performed  for every A/E contract in order to ensure that the airport properly evaluates the cost of professional services, and receives a fair and reasonable fee.  By providing this service, Dennis Corporation ensures that funds are being utilized as efficiently as possible while still maintaining the quality of work expected to ensure that the airport functions adequately.
